Key Responsibilities

  • •Install, repair, and overhaul general plant mechanical equipment (turbines, pumps, compressors, conveyors, pulverizers, and related components).
  • •Work from drawings and sketches; ensure equipment is properly isolated and protected before starting work.
  • •Obtain required materials from storeroom and set up rigging; operate lifting equipment when required.
  • •Erect and work from scaffolds; operate mobile/shop equipment and portable tools to complete assigned jobs.
  • •Operate cutting/heating torches (including checking for explosive gases when necessary) and prepare reports/forms for work completed.

Key Requirements

  • •Qualification standards established in the Apprenticeship Program, or—if no graduating apprentice is available—requirements under the Supplementary Agreement on Uniform Practices Regarding Promotion to Machinist Repairman Jobs.
  • •Ability to perform skilled machinist work requiring tolerances as low as +.0005".
  • •Accurate, steady, and calm in emergencies with normal physical strength and endurance.
  • •No color deficiency in vision.
  • •Ability to observe and follow safety instructions and prescribed safety precautions.

Company Brief

Ameren
Ameren is an investor-owned energy company that generates, transmits and distributes electricity and natural gas to customers across Missouri and Illinois, focusing on grid reliability, regulated utility operations and investments in cleaner energy solutions.
